Instructions for use for Saline solution 0.9% Ecoflac Plus, 10X250 ml
Isotonic saline solution 0.9% Braun infusion solution
The isotonic saline solution 0.9% Braun is an infusion solution that is used universally in infusion therapy.It is stable, easy to grip and break-proof, has an integrated hanger and does not require any ventilation.The puncture port is already germ-free, which makes handling easier.The solution also saves space when transporting, storing and disposing of items.It is DEHP/PVC-free and latex-free.
Areas of application
The isotonic saline solution 0.9% brown is used to replace fluids and salt in cases of fluid deficiency (isotonic dehydration) or simultaneous sodium and fluid deficiency (hypotonic dehydration).It is also used when the pH value is increased and the chloride level is simultaneously reduced (hypochloremic alkalosis) and when there is a loss of chloride.It is also used for short-term filling of the vascular system (intravascular volume replacement), as a carrier solution for electrolyte concentrates and compatible medications, as well as for wound treatment and for moistening cloths and bandages.
Active ingredient and composition
The active ingredient of the isotonic saline solution 0.9% brown is sodium chloride.1000 ml of the infusion solution contains 9.0 g sodium chloride.The other ingredient is water for injections.The electrolytes in the solution are sodium ions (154 mmol/l) and chloride ions (154 mmol/l).
Application and dosage
The isotonic saline solution 0.9% Braun is applied intravenously or used for rinsing and moistening.The dosage depends on fluid and electrolyte needs.The maximum dose is 40 ml per kg body weight per day, which corresponds to 6 mmol sodium per kg body weight per day.The solution is usually administered at up to 5 ml per kg of body weight per hour, which corresponds to around 1.7 drops per kg of body weight per minute.In exceptional cases, such as after major blood loss, the solution can also be administered at a higher rate as a pressure infusion.
Side effects and precautions
Like all medicines, the isotonic saline solution 0.9% Braun can have side effects, although not everyone gets them.Possible side effects include increased levels of sodium and chloride in the blood (hypernatremia and hyperchloremia).The solution must not be used if overwatering is present.Particular caution is required if there is a low level of potassium in the blood (hypokalemia), an increased level of sodium in the blood (hypernatremia), an increased level of chloride in the blood (hyperchloremia) and certain diseases such as heart failure, fluid accumulation in the tissues, pulmonary edema, high blood pressure, eclampsia and severe kidney dysfunction.
Storage
The isotonic saline solution 0.9% brown should be kept out of the reach of children.No special storage conditions are required.The medicine must not be used after the expiry date stated on the container and the outer carton.The solution should not be used if cloudiness, suspended particles, or damage to the container or closure is noted.From a microbiological point of view, the preparation should be used immediately after first opening.If not used immediately, storage time should normally not exceed 24 hours at 2 to 8°C.Any infusion solution that is not used after one application should be discarded.
